It is sort of difficult to explain, especially over the internet. A lot of baseball is making educated guesses. Knowing the right time to steal a base, the right time to bunt, the right time to hit and run, the right time to throw a changeup, the right time to throw inside...and so on and so on.

Not to mention it's all about situations too and what to do when they come up. Batter has a 3-1 count, does he take the pitch that might be ball 4 or should he swing away? Speedy runner on first, do you keep holding him on throwing over to first or just ignore and pitch away? There are many other situations that require a lot of thinking.
